Chen Ruiguo, deputy director of the International Bamboo and Rattan Center, member of the party committee, senior engineer.


In July 1991, he graduated from Central South Forestry College majoring in landscape architecture. From July 1991 to November 1993, he worked in the Landscape Engineering Office of the Beijing Forestry Survey and Design Institute and the Personnel Office of the Beijing Forestry Bureau. In December 1993, he was transferred to the Engineering Design Office of the Survey, Planning and Design Institute of the Ministry of Forestry. In 1996, he served as a temporary office. Person in charge (deputy division level), engineer. From October 1997 to January 2011, he worked in the Capital Construction Division of the Comprehensive Planning Department of the Ministry of Forestry and the Construction Management Division of the Planning and Finance Division of the State Forestry Administration, successively serving as assistant investigator and deputy director. (Period: October 2005 to 2006 In January 2010, he studied at the Party School of the State Forestry Administration, and from November 2009 to March 2010, he studied English at Beijing International Studies University), and in February 2011, he served as the Timber Industry Management Office (Industry Development Office) of the Development Planning and Fund Management Department of the State Forestry Administration. Director. In March 2014, he was transferred to the International Bamboo and Rattan Center of the State Forestry Administration, and successively served as a member of the party committee, assistant to the director, director of the planning and finance department, and director of the general office. In December 2017, he served as deputy director and party committee member of the International Bamboo and Rattan Center.
